The Paddie 360° Swivel Electric Height Adjustable Tattoo Spa Chair combines professional-grade durability with ergonomic design and advanced electric controls. Featuring a heavy-duty steel frame supporting up to 440lbs, a whisper-quiet electric height adjustment from 21'' to 33'', and a versatile 360° swivel with locking mechanism, it ensures maximum comfort and efficiency for tattoo artists and estheticians. Its oil-resistant PU leather surface, detachable storage pocket, and adjustable headrest and armrests make it a must-have for modern studios aiming to impress and retain clients.

Just okay
Quality less than expected. There are rust spots on the metal base, a tear/cut in the left arm rest, and the footrest is too big - it’s in the way when all the way down because it still sticks out at an angle and randomly collapses on lower settings so it has to be either completely lowered and off of the support bar or all the way up. I mistakenly assumed that all the functions were electric but only up/down is. Even the lowest height is just a little too high for shorter clients, especially with the footrest sticking out the way it does. Footrest and back are manual adjustments and sort of awkward. I’d rather have a hydraulic chair at this rate and not have to worry about the cord.Assembly - would recommend two people. Read the instructions carefully - some of the illustrations are confusing and it’s easy to get pieces on backwards or upside down and you won’t realize it until several steps later.Bolt that secures the rotation of the chair is bent. Was able to barely get it loose enough to spin the chair and then get it just barely in the groove enough to sort of lock it but it’s not secure the way it should be. Because of the way it’s bent the bolt can’t be removed and replaced which would have been a simple solution.The chair is too awkward and heavy to bother with trying to disassemble and return it but I would if it was feasible. Will probably end up replacing it with a better quality chair within a year if not sooner.Technically it is usable which is why I gave it 3 stars but it probably deserves 2.5. Overall would not recommend but maybe I got a dud.
